AdkAction & CDPHP Wellness Surveys at Saranac Lake Farmers Market

AdkAction has been working with long-standing supporter, CDPHP®, to administer a wellness survey at the Saranac Lake Farmers Market throughout the market season. 

The wellness survey focuses on food security, local food, and the shopping habits of participants who take the survey. Survey questions include food security screening questions, general demographic information, and lifestyle preferences. Insights on what health issues and resources are most important to local residents of the North Country will be gathered through the ten-minute survey, which is administered by AdkAction staff and volunteers. All participants in the survey can remain anonymous in their answers. 

Wellness survey participants will be given two $5 vouchers to spend at approved market vendors. CDPHP has generously funded these vouchers so that market vendors are reimbursed the same day they are used at the Saranac Lake Farmers Market. If you are a resident of Clinton, Essex, Franklin, or Hamilton county please be sure to stop by our booth at the market and support our work by participating in this survey.

About the market: The Saranac Lake Farmers market operates every Saturday from 9am – 1pm, now until October 8th, and is located at Riverside Park in Saranac Lake.

About CDPHP: Established in 1984, CDPHP is a physician-founded, member-focused, and community-based not-for-profit health plan that offers high-quality affordable health insurance plans to members in 29 counties throughout New York. We are incredibly thankful to CDPHP for supporting our food security work and helping us survey those living in our community.
